CHANNEL-BILLED CUCKOO
The 'Channel-billed Cuckoo' ('''Scythrops novaehollandiae''') is a species of cuckoo in the Cuculidae family. It is monotypic within the genus '''Scythrops'''.
It is found in Australia, Indonesia, New Caledonia, New Zealand, and Papua New Guinea.
Its natural habitats are subtropical or tropical moist lowland forests and subtropical or tropical mangrove forests.
